The focus of the workshop is actually to give awareness to the user of Siemens DCS (Distributed Control System) on the importance to have defense from cyber attack as the attack could also comes from inside. Within the I & C (Instrumentation and Control) Systems. Where it actually serves as "central nervous system" in the power plant. Especially when nowadays too many attack goes to nuclear power plant.

Below is the list of symtomps when you consume seawater.
1) from http://science.howstuffworks.com/science-vs-myth/what-if/what-if-you-drink-saltwater1.htm

If you're consuming seawater, the results of osmosis are spectacularly disastrous. Remember the salinity of seawater is almost four times that of our bodily fluids. If gone unchecked, the net transfer of water from the inside of your cells to the outside will cause the cells to shrink considerably -- and shrinkage is never good.
The body tries to compensate for fluid loss by increasing the heart rate and constricting blood vessels to maintain blood pressure and flow to vital organs. You're also most likely to feel nausea, weakness and even delirium. As you become more dehydrated, the coping mechanism fails. If you still don't drink any water to reverse the effects of excess sodium, the brain and other organs receive less blood, leading to coma, organ failure and eventually death.

2) from http://www.livestrong.com/article/156036-what-are-the-side-effects-of-drinking-sea-water/

Drinking saltwater will cause a number of early side effects as you get dehydrated. Dry mouth and rapid heartbeat are followed by low blood pressure, headaches and dizziness. Lethargy and confusion will eventually start to set in. Depending on how much sea water you had to drink and whether you’re now drinking fresh water to eliminate the effects, you can also experience blood in the stool or vomit, loss of appetite and unconsciousness,

3) http://healthyeating.sfgate.com/dangerous-consume-much-salt-water-11580.html

Studies show that consuming too much salt causes your body to expel more calcium through urine, according to the Linus Pauling Institute. Your bones need this calcium, and thus may become weaker over time. You may become more vulnerable to osteoporosis, a condition in which bones grow brittle and more prone to fracture. Increased urinary calcium may also lead to kidney stones, a condition in which hard calcium masses form in the kidneys. When these stones get stuck in the urinary tract, they can cause bleeding and severe pain, and may block the flow of urine.
